Nutritional Benefits of Sweet Potato and Sausage Soup

This soup is not only delicious, but it’s also packed with health benefits! Sweet potatoes are loaded with vitamins A and C, both of which are great for your immune system and skin health. They also provide a good dose of fiber, which helps with digestion and keeps you full. The sausage adds protein, and if you use a lean sausage or turkey sausage, it can be a lighter option without sacrificing flavor. The combination of these ingredients makes for a hearty, nutritious soup that satisfies both your taste buds and your body!

Adaptable Variations to Make

  • Spicy Kick: Add a pinch of red pepper flakes or cayenne pepper to give the soup a little heat and extra flavor.
  • Vegetarian Version: Use plant-based sausage or add lentils or chickpeas for a vegetarian protein source.
  • Extra Veggies: Feel free to toss in some kale, spinach, or zucchini to up the veggie content and add more nutrients.

Sweet Potato and Sausage Soup Recipe

Ingredients

  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1 lb sausage (mild or spicy), casing removed and crumbled
  • 1 large onion, ch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 2 large sweet potatoes, peeled and diced
  • 4 cups chicken or vegetable broth
  • 1 can (14.5 oz) diced tomatoes
  • 1 teaspoon dried thyme
  • Salt and pepper, to taste
  • 2 cups spinach or kale (optional)
  • F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)

Instructions

  1. In a large pot, heat the olive oil over medium heat. Add the crumbled sausage and cook until browned, breaking it up as it cooks, about 5-7 minutes.
  2. Add the chopped onion and garlic to the pot, and sauté for about 3 minutes, or until the onion is softened and translucent.
  3. Stir in the diced sweet potatoes, chicken or vegetable broth, diced tomatoes, dried thyme, salt, and pepper. Bring the soup to a boil.
  4. Once boiling, reduce the heat to low, cover, and simmer for 15-20 minutes, or until the sweet potatoes are tender and the flavors have melded together.
  5. If you’re adding spinach or kale, stir them in during the last 5 minutes of cooking.
  6. Once the soup is ready, taste and adjust the seasoning as needed. Garnish with fresh parsley before serving. Enjoy!

Practical Tips for a Perfect Soup

  • If you prefer a thicker soup, you can mash some of the sweet potatoes with a potato masher to give the soup a creamier texture.
  • For a little extra richness, try adding a splash of coconut milk or heavy cream in the last few minutes of cooking.
  • This soup stores well in the fridge for 3-4 days, and it also freezes beautifully for a meal later on!
